We are currently seeking an experienced and dependable Working Foreman with a solid background in heavy industrial yard environments (Groundworks). This is a hands-on position where you will take responsibility for overseeing and coordinating site operations, ensuring all works are completed safely, efficiently, and to a high standard.
You will be actively involved in supervising and delivering a range of groundworks, including:
- Concrete paving
- Concrete road construction for articulated vehicle access
- Servicing pits
- Drainage systems
- Kerb laying
Projects are located across London, Essex, and the Home Counties, therefore a flexible approach to travel is essential.
Rate: £250 – £270 per day (depending on experience)
Temporary to permanent.
